Hello, I select consecutive rows on a sheet and run this code to sort A>Z for those selected rows but it only works correctly with 4 rows. I want to be able to select more or in some cases fewer than 4 rows to be sorted. The selected rows will always start as consecutive rows on the sheet. Thanks



Code:
Sub Sort()

    ActiveWorkbook.Worksheets("EnterSheet").Sort.SortFields.Clear
    ActiveWorkbook.Worksheets("EnterSheet").Sort.SortFields.Add Key:=ActiveCell. _
        Offset(0, 5).Range("A1:A4"), SortOn:=xlSortOnValues, Order:=xlAscending, _
        DataOption:=xlSortNormal
    With ActiveWorkbook.Worksheets("EnterSheet").Sort
        .SetRange ActiveCell.Range("A1:AK4")
        .Header = xlGuess
        .MatchCase = False
        .Orientation = xlTopToBottom
        .SortMethod = xlPinYin
        .Apply
    End With
End Sub
I have added a sample attachment.It seems the range needs to be changed.

try:
Code:
Sub Sort2()
Set SortRng = Intersect(Selection.EntireRow, Columns("A:AK"))
If Not SortRng Is Nothing Then SortRng.Sort Columns("F"), xlAscending, Header:=xlNo
End Sub
